Power and efficiency. The AMR21 is powered by the Mercedes-AMG F1 M12 E Performance, a 1.6-litre V6 turbo-hybrid power unit, which is a product of Formula One’s stable engine regulations that have produced the most efficient Formula One engines ever constructed.

Did Aston Martin buy racing point? Racing Point owner Lawrence Stroll’s purchasing of a significant stake in the Aston Martin company in 2020 paved the way for Racing Point to morph into the Aston Martin works team for this season.
Considering this Which F1 team did Aston Martin take over? Racing Point made their racing debut at the 2019 Australian Grand Prix. The team’s drivers for the 2020 season were Sergio Pérez and Lance Stroll. The team has been rebranded to Aston Martin for the 2021 Formula One season.

Is Aston Martin owned by Ford? Aston Martin was founded in London in 1913. Ford bought 75 percent of the brand in 1987 for an undisclosed amount and took full ownership in 1994 as it opened a new factory for the brand in Bloxham, England.

What will Racing Point be called in 2021?
The 2020 Abu Dhabi Grand Prix may have been the last time we see the names Racing Point and Renault competing in Formula 1. For the 2021 season, these two teams have been rebranded as Aston Martin and Alpine, respectively.
Why did Renault change to Alpine? And why did they change its name to Alpine this season? … This year, Renault boss Luca De Meo reorganized the company to put greater focus on its four key brands – Renault, Dacia, Alpine, and New Mobility. Alpine is their sports car brand, and it made sense to promote it via the greatest motor-racing sport on Earth.
Is Aston Martin owned by Mercedes?
2013–present: Partnership with Daimler AG
In 2013, Aston Martin signed a deal with Daimler AG, which owned a 5% stake in Aston Martin, to supply the next generation of Aston Martin cars with Mercedes-AMG engines. Mercedes-AMG also was to supply Aston Martin with electrical systems.

What does DB stand for in Aston Martin? Sir David Brown was a tractor manufacturer, who purchased Aston Martin along with Lagonda in an effort to get into the road car business. Ever since it’s been David Brown whose initials have adorned the best Aston Martin has to offer – the DB cars.

What engines will McLaren use in 2021?
McLaren have a new Mercedes power unit in the 2021 F1 season
In 2019, the British outfit signed Mercedes as their engine suppliers from the 2021 season onwards. They were the only team to change engine suppliers this season, with the remaining teams sticking to their engine suppliers from 2020.
